
Five-time champions Mumbai Indians started their training camp almost two weeks before the start of the IPL. Some stars like captain Hardik Pandya and Arjun Tendulkar have joined this camp. The Mumbai franchise has shared a video of Arjun in which he is seen bowling in full rhythm to the left-handed batsman. In the nets, Arjun bowled an excellent yorker ball on a straight leg to the batsman, due to which the batsman lost his balance and fell to the ground. Many social media users believe that he is batsman Ishan Kishan. Ishan has been in the news for some time regarding red-ball cricket.
Ishan's name missing
After this, Arjun throws another ball which falls between the legs of the left-handed batsman. Even the batsman is surprised to see these balls. However, Mumbai Indians released the list of players who took part in the practice session and Ishan Kishan's name was missing in it. Mumbai Indians said in a press release, 'The team started their first practice session with a grilling session in the nets in which captain Hardik Pandya, Gerald Coetzee, Shreyas Gopal, Nehal Wadhera, Akash Madhwal, Arjun Tendulkar, Vishnu Vinod, Shivalik Sharma, Naman Dheer, Anshul Kamboj were among the other players who practiced at the CCI ground.
Arjun was included in their team by Mumbai in 2021, but it took two years for him to debut. Arjun played a total of four matches for the franchise in IPL 2023. Looking at his performance in the nets, Arjun may remain in the playing eleven for a long time this time. The 17th season of IPL will start on March 22, in which defending champions Chennai Super Kings (CSK) will face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B) at their home ground.
Last year's runners-up Gujarat Titans and five-time champions Mumbai Indians will face each other in Ahmedabad on March 24. Star all-rounder Pandya's move to his former franchise MI after two brilliant seasons with GT had created quite a stir. Shubman Gill has taken over the captaincy of GT. Now Hardik's first match with MI against his former franchise is going to be very interesting.
